Step 7 — Migrate the tax-rate lookup cache in Corvalindex. The legacy cache keyed entries by region code only, which caused stale rates after mid-quarter regulatory updates in the Velmora territories. The new schema keys by region plus effective date and enforces a hard TTL. Before cutover, drain the old cache completely; partial drains leave poisoned entries that survive restarts. Confirm the warm-up job finishes (roughly twelve minutes) before routing traffic. The cache service must then be restarted with the following configuration values.

deployment values, hahag-kahap:
[quenwyn]
team = zormir
access_code = ac_b7f4f2
owner = queneth.casvan
host = quenwyn.zemvarcorp.example
port = 9090
peer = oliir.olvarqdata.corp
salt = 3d732bf1
pin = 3832

# FareLogic rules engine — shipping fee configuration
#
# Welcome aboard. This file configures the FareLogic evaluator, which prices
# shipments based on zone tables published by the Cartwheel rates service.
# RULESET_VERSION pins the active rule bundle; bump it only after the bundle
# passes the replay suite. ZONE_CACHE_TTL defaults to 300 seconds and rarely
# needs changing. Everything here is safe to share except the last entry:
# the Cartwheel rates API credential, which goes on the next line.

secret setting of yagef-baweg: RELAY_SECRET29=cb53deb59a49ed54d9f43599b54ca

Confirmed: the Pexley thumbnail cache never evicts decoded bitmaps, so heap grows until OOM on long sessions. This patch adds LRU eviction plus a hard byte cap. Risk is low; eviction only triggers above threshold. Recommend including in the 3.8.1 hotfix rather than waiting for 3.9. Eviction behavior is governed by these constants:

tuning table, yajog-yahof:
BUDGETS = {
    "lamvan": 303,
    "wenox": 460,
    "fenvan": 525,
}